Synthetic Peptide Antigens to Detect Anti-Nephrin Autoantibodies
NU2025-147 Inventors Jing Jin* Pan Liu Short Description The invention provides a method for detecting anti-nephrin autoantibodies implicated in kidney diseases like minimal change disease (MCD) and focal segmental glomerulosclerosis (FSGS). Magnetic Resonance Contrast Agents for the Detection and Imaging of Senescence
NU 2024-024 INVENTORS Thomas Meade* Heike Daldrup-Link SHORT DESCRIPTION An MRI probe to detect senescent cells in vivo and in real-time.
